The Company: Cognex Corporation
Cognex is the worlds leading provider of vision systems software sensors and industrial barcode readers used in manufacturing automation. Cognex vision helps companies improve product quality eliminate production errors lower manufacturing costs and exceed consumer expectations for high quality products at an affordable price. Typical applications for machine vision include detecting defects monitoring production lines guiding assembly robots and tracking sorting and identifying parts.
Cognex serves an international customer base from offices located throughout the Americas Europe and Asia and through a global network of integration and distribution partners. The company is headquartered close to Boston in Natick Massachusetts
The Role: As an Information Security Engineer you will work with our InfoSec analysts and engineers to locate and improve weak points in our security and mature Cognex InfoSec program. You may suggest new hardware or develop software to fix any issues. You will also perform routine maintenance to keep our security systems running efficiently and defend the network and systems from various cybersecurity threats. Security engineers assist in protecting sensitive data as well as developing secure systems and responding to cyberattacks.
Develop and implement security policies and procedures
Develop and maintain the organizations security framework in alignment with business goals and objectives
Maintaining and monitoring security systems (i.e. firewalls IDS/IPS VPNs Endpoint security platforms SIEM TVM)
Progress & mature Cognex security program
Security Assessments
Risk Analyses Vulnerability Assessments Penetration Testing
Develop mitigation strategies
Collaborate with InfoSec & IT
Stay up to date on emerging threats vulnerabilities and security technologies
Be a champion for InfoSec to employees on information security policies procedures and best practices
Knowledge:
Understanding of information & cyber security concepts principles best practices common types of cyber threats and attack vectors and security frameworks such as NIST ISO 27001 CIS and HITRUST
Knowledge of network and system administration including cloud environments firewalls intrusion detection and prevention systems operating systems databases applications protocols and other security tools
Understanding of encryption cryptography web application security secure coding practices proxies architecture and assessment tools and techniques
Intermediate knowledge of regulatory compliance requirements such as Sarbanes Oxley PCI-DSS HIPAA GDPR CCPA etc.
Intermediate understanding of incident response disaster recovery and Business Continuity plan procedures including forensic analysis techniques
Familiarity with cloud security concepts and practices including DevSecOps
